Hey All.
Been a while since i've posted here but my brother is having a problem with his GT-R celica. It's a non turbo, 2L 16v. 3SGE.

The story..
Noob was driving and got really low on gas. Stopped and put some gas in it, started it up and continued on his way.
Headed down the motorway, got to the end and stopped in traffic and car started running rough, spluttering like it was running out of gas but there was still plenty in the tank according to the gauge. Then it died completely. Have been unable to start it since.

He took plugs out and they looked rooted so he's changed them, its got plenty of gas now, plenty of power.
Turns over but doesnt fire.
Thinking fuel supply problem but he reckons the pump is running fine, he says he's heard it run though.
He also says he's taken off the fuel line, (if you are looking at it from the radiator it is on the right hand side) and nothing comes out when he turns it over.. I dont know if this is the feed or the return cos i'm a noob too.

Anyone got any suggestions/want to come look at it?

Does it have a fuel filter? If it does, I know that when my dads van got run low on fuel the fuel filters cardboard got ripped to pieces and filled the fuel lines. He had to clean the fuel lines of all the cardboard befor it would start.

Yeah, a couple of cars Ive owned didnt have filters, mostly its european cars that aren't fitted with them.

Im not too sure about Celicas but if there is a filter its probably mounted on the firewall. More than likely black. Its hard to explain the shape though, Cylindrical I guess. On my last two toyotas it was mounted on the right hand side of the firewall when looking at the front of the vehicle.

ok filter i think is a cylinder that is on the passengers side of the engine bay.
It appears to have a hose coming out of the top of it. It goes into the top of the engine and when you pull it off is dry as a bone,
There is another hose that goes into the back of the engine under what i think is the injectors and its a bit wet, like its had fuel but it goes straight down and under the car, i think back to the tank.
Neither hose produces fuel when you crank it and put them in a jar.
There is a big hose that appears to go into the bottom of the filter but I cannot tell if it actually goes into the filter or through into the wheel arch (maybe brake line)
We took the back seat out and the panel off where the fuel pump is and cranked the bolt on the top of it with a socket set. fuel immediately started running down the side of where the bolt was. we didnt undo it any more than this, just did it back up
